Ingredients for Festive Peppermint Mocha Bread

To craft this delectable Festive Peppermint Mocha Bread, you will need the following ingredients:

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our: For a tender and fluffy texture.
  • ½ teaspoon baking soda: To help the bread rise perfectly.
  • ¼ teaspoon salt: To enhance flavors.
  • 1 cup granulated sugar: To add sweetness.
  • ½ cup baking cocoa: For a rich chocolate flavor.
  • ¼ cup instant coffee granules: To infuse a lovely coffee essence.
  • 1¼ cups sour cream: For moistness and a slight tang.
  • 2 large eggs: To bind the ingredients together.
  • ⅓ cup melted butter: Adds richness and depth.
  • 1 cup white chocolate peppermint chips: For that seasonal twist!
  • ½ cup semi-sweet chocolate chips: For an extra chocolatey flavor.
  • 4 tbsp hot fudge sauce (optional topping): To elevate the loaf.
  • 1 crushed candy cane (optional garnish): For that festive crunch.
  • Non-stick spray for greasing the pan: To prevent sticking.

Step-by-Step Directions for Festive Peppermint Mocha Bread

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×5-inch loaf pan with non-stick spray to ensure easy removal post-baking.

  2. In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, salt, baking soda, granulated sugar, cocoa powder, and instant coffee granules. This mixture is the dry base of your bread.

  3. In a separate large bowl, mix the sour cream, eggs, and melted butter whisking until smooth and creamy.

  4.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, stirring gently to combine. Be careful not to overmix—this prevents a dense loaf!

  5. Fold in the peppermint chips and semi-sweet chocolate chips, ensuring an even distribution throughout the batter for bursts of flavor.

  6. Pour the prepared batter into the greased loaf pan, smoothing out the top with a spatula for an even bake.

  7. Bake in the preheated oven for 50–55 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

  8. Allow the loaf to c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ack. For an indulgent touch, drizzle it with hot fudge sauce and sprinkle with crushed candy canes.

Tips & Tricks

To ensure your Festive Peppermint Mocha Bread turns out perfectly every time, here are some helpful tips:

  • Room Temperature Ingredients: Make sure your eggs and sour cream are at room temperature before using them; this helps the batter mix together smoothly.

  • Don’t Overmix: Be careful not to overmix the batter once the dry ingredients are added. This helps the bread remain light and fluffy.

  • Add Extras: Feel free to get creative! Add chopped nuts or different types of chocolate chips for additional texture and flavor.

  • Freezing: This bread freezes wonderfully.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and foil to keep it fresh, thawing it at room temperature when you’re ready to enjoy.

Storing Tips & Variations for Festive Peppermint Mocha Bread

To keep your Festive Peppermint Mocha Bread fresh, store it in an airtight container at room temperature for up to four days. Alternatively, you can wrap it tightly and freeze it for up to three months, ensuring that each slice retains its sumptuous flavor. For those looking to make healthier swaps, consider using whole wheat flour or a sugar substitute. You could also create a mocha-inspired swirl by adding a layer of cream cheese filling, or experiment with chocolate and caramel chips for a unique twist!

FAQs

  1. Can I substitute the sour cream?
    Yes, plain yogurt or buttermilk can be used as a substitute for sour cream if needed.

  2. How can I make this recipe gluten-free?
    You can use a gluten-free all-purpose flour blend to make this bread gluten-free.

  3. What if I don’t have instant coffee granules?
    You can use brewed coffee instead, but reduce the sour cream slightly to keep the batter at the right consistency.

  4. Can I make this ahead of time?
    Absolutely! You can bake it a day in advance, and it tastes even better the next day as the flavors meld together.

  5. How should I store leftover bread?
    Keep any leftover bread in an airtight container at room temperature for up to four days, or freeze for longer storage.
